The Medisafe Sonic Irrigator (SI) PCF automated cleaning system is validated for cleaning and thermal disinfection of daVinci® EndoWrist® instruments.
Medisafe Sonic Irrigator “PCF”- is the most versatile instrument cleaning system available today. Now available as purchase option, thermal disinfection for complex cannulated instruments both inside and out, in a fully validated and tested process. (See disinfection model option below)
Cleaning then disinfecting up to 20 standard lumened instruments at temperatures up to 195ºF both inside and out, in approximately 45-minutes per cycle.
Through our dedicated daVinci cycle, the SI PCF system offers an efficient and convenient way to clean up to 10 EndoWrist instruments simultaneously. For daVinci customers with EndoWrist instruments the Medisafe SI-PCF systems can perform both qualified cleaning along with disinfection by simply selecting “cycle #6” on systems digital display. For the qualified EndoWrist cleaning cycle without disinfection, select “cycle #3”.
Thermal disinfection for EndoWrist instruments may not be available in all countries.

Wash Cycle Parameters
Min. Temp. During Cycle: determined by temperature of water supply
Max. Temp. During Cycle: 91° C / 195° F
Vol. of Dispensed Chemicals
Wash chemical: Detergent 414ml / 14.0oz (approx)
Final rinse chemical: 414ml / 14.0oz (approx)
Electricity Supply
208V / 3phase / 60Hz
24 AMPS per phase max
15K watts
Lead Length: 5 feet
Printer:
Supply Voltage: single phase 110v / 0.1 amps (nominal) AC
Required Utilities
Water Supply
Cold water supply terminating into a Male ¾” NPT National Pipe Thread hose fitting
Hot water supply terminating into a Male ¾” NPT National Pipe Thread hose fitting.
Acceptable Pressure Range:
2.0 – 5.0 BAR (29 –72 PSI) hot & cold
Acceptable Incoming Water Temperature Range:
Hot: 104°F - 140°F
Cold 41°F – 95°F
Hardness CaCo3: less than 110 ppm (HTM2030)
Drain
Type: Single 4” diameter floor drain fitted with suitable traps on building side within 20” of equipment
>OR<
Wall drain not more than 14” from floor is acceptable (no more than 48” from equipment) Wall drain must accept 2.5” collar in diameter and be greater than 8 gallons per min.
Max. Flow to Drain: 8 gallons per min
Max. Temp. of Effluent: 91° C / 195° F.
